Output 1e3c5031af6f2e16b27771d08f1a1c6be8cc6374afeca54e554f1bb5188fc50b:2

value
2625892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c5df98ab4ba84f6d6822ac4b8f34ef27d8a6ad6 OP_EQUAL
address
3Ba1Uk46x3V5XYU3pJLmdniEyevG3u3L3i
transaction
1e3c5031af6f2e16b27771d08f1a1c6be8cc6374afeca54e554f1bb5188fc50b
confirmations
145661
spent
true